How Delino DeShields Jr.'s Range Factor Compares to Similar Players

Delino DeShields Jr. posted a career Range Factor of 2.28, well below the league average of 3.1 — production that significantly underperformed against league baselines. His best Range Factor season came in 2018, posting 2.76, near the league average of 2.62 that year. The lowest point came in 2016 at 1.75, well below the league average of 2.73 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from 2.76 in 2018 to 2.35 in 2019 and 1.75 in 2021.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Some season-to-season variance runs through the career line, but the career average remained well below league norms across 6 seasons.
